I purchased this set as a Birthday present for a friend. When it arrived, I checked to make sure it had no problems. Unfortunately, Daddy had what looked like white chunks on the inside of the lipstick and both lippies appeared to be half full. Obviously I couldn't give this as a gift anymore, and I emailed Beautylish for a refund on what is obviously a faulty product. Although the Beautylish team was nice, it took quite a few exchanges of email to get a refund (and only $20 dollars back, Eclipse on it's own costs $29, but I was tired of emailing back and forth to get something that should have been done asap for a few more dollars). I threw out Daddy and tried on I'm Shook which had a stronger chemical smell than normal JS lippies, and I was surprised that it burnt my lips. I do have dry lips and after years of putting them through all kinds matte lippies, I have never experienced anything like this. This has been a really disappointing experience.
